The Art of Spatial Storytelling
3D game design is more than just visual fidelity; it is about how a player interacts with a space. The best 3D games use architecture and lighting to guide the player intuitively, creating a narrative flow that doesn't rely solely on dialogue. We analyze how female level designers are incorporating organic flow and psychological triggers into their maps to create more intuitive and engaging experiences.
